Lawn care in Shippensburg, PA is an essential task for homeowners who want to maintain a healthy and aesthetically pleasing yard. The climate in Shippensburg is characterized by warm, humid summers and mild to cool winters, which means that different lawn care tasks are needed at different times of the year.

Mowing is a critical part of lawn care in neighborhoods like Timberland Estates and Thornwood Village. The key is to mow regularly, but not too short. Cutting your grass too short can stress it and make it more susceptible to pests and diseases. As a rule of thumb, never remove more than one-third of the grass blade in a single mowing. In Shippensburg, the growing season typically starts in late spring and lasts through the fall, so plan on mowing your lawn once a week during these periods.

Fertilizing is another essential task that can help keep your lawn healthy and green. The best time to fertilize your lawn in Shippensburg is in the late spring and early fall when the grass is actively growing. Use a slow-release granular fertilizer that will nourish your lawn over several months. Be sure to follow the manufacturer's instructions for the best results.

Seeding is also a crucial lawn care task in Shippensburg, especially in areas that are prone to bare spots, like near Memorial Park. The best time to seed your lawn is in the early fall when the soil temperatures are optimal for seed germination. Be sure to water the newly seeded areas regularly to help the seeds establish.

Aerating and dethatching are additional tasks that can help improve the health of your lawn. Aerating helps to loosen compacted soil and improve water and nutrient absorption, while dethatching removes the layer of dead grass and organic matter that can build up on the surface of your lawn. The best time to aerate and dethatch your lawn in Shippensburg is in the early spring or fall when the grass is actively growing.

Watering is another important aspect of lawn care. The soil in Shippensburg tends to be loamy, which holds water well but can also become compacted if overwatered. In general, it's best to water your lawn deeply and infrequently, rather than shallow and often. Aim for about 1 to 1.5 inches of water per week, including rainfall. Be mindful of any water restrictions in your area, especially during the drier summer months.
